As a Kitchen Assistant, you will be instrumental in:

  • Preparing and serving delicious, healthy meals and snacks tailored to diverse dietary needs.
  • Upholding impeccable standards of food safety and hygiene.
  • Performing essential cleaning tasks, including dishwashing, floor mopping, and maintaining spotless food preparation areas.
  • Managing food supplies and ensuring compliance with all relevant legislation and guidelines.
  • Contributing to a positive, collaborative work environment and building strong relationships with children and families.
  • Supporting a culture of continuous improvement and participating in professional development activities.

Position Requirements:

  • Relevant Qualifications: Certificate III in Early Childhood Education and Care (Desirable), food service and handling certificates, understanding of FSANZ Code, and a current First Aid qualification (ACECQA guidelines).
  • Experience & Skills: Proven experience in preparing nutritious meals, knowledge of food safety and hygiene, and the ability to manage food supplies effectively.
  • Organizational Ability: Strong time management skills and the capability to perform duties within time constraints.
  • Teamwork & Independence: Ability to work effectively both independently and collaboratively in a team environment.
  • Training & Compliance: Competency in providing food safety training and maintaining compliance with statutory regulations and QIAS.
  • Personal Qualities: Commitment to our Christian values, strong communication skills, and the ability to build supportive relationships with staff, children, and parents.
